Area village records first homicide in 2 decades
Officials say 50-year-old Agustin Lebron-Morales of Mount Morris entered a building at Highland Hospital Monday afternoon and asked for help contacting police.
Earlier in the day, police found the body of 40-year-old Sonia Valera inside the home she and Lebron-Morales shared in Mount Morris, 33 miles south of Rochester. It was the village's first homicide in more than 20 years.
Authorities say Valera had been stabbed during an argument.
Police say Lebron-Morales has pleaded innocent to a second-degree murder charge. He's being held without bail Tuesday in the Livingston County Jail and is due back in court Friday.
